snippets : trouver tous les fichiers qui contiennent un pattern

Shell : trouver tous les fichiers qui contiennent un patternAffiche toutes les lignes contenant 'todo' (insensible a la casse avec -i) dans tous les fichiers .py du repertoire en cours et recursivement. Affiche 2 lignes au dessous et en dessous du match, le nom du fichier, et colore les matches dans le term. 'todo' peut etre une expression régulière.
#!/bin/sh

find . -iname '*.py' -exec grep -H -B 2 -A 2 --color -i todo {} \;
tags : system, linux, regexp, bash

all tags : python, system, vlc, video, apache, proxy, linux, django, MySQL, .NET, XML, XSL, regexp, bat, windows, bash, git

back to snippets home
site réalisé et hébergé par revolunet © 2009 - informations légales